The business problem manufacturers are trying to solve
On the shop floor, production events happen in real time. Machines complete runs, operators log scrap, quality teams record inspections, maintenance systems trigger downtime events, and warehouse teams move raw materials and finished goods. In many organizations, the ERP system remains the financial and operational system of record, but it often receives updates late, inconsistently, or through manual entry. That gap creates inventory inaccuracies, production planning errors, delayed order status visibility, duplicate data entry, and weak operational intelligence.

Where middleware modernization creates the most value
Legacy manufacturing environments often rely on brittle file transfers, point-to-point scripts, aging on-prem middleware, or manual exports from shop floor applications into ERP modules. Middleware modernization replaces those fragile methods with an API integration platform and enterprise orchestration platform approach that supports event-driven processing, transformation logic, exception handling, auditability, and operational resilience. This is especially important when manufacturers operate multiple plants, mixed equipment generations, or hybrid cloud and on-prem application estates.
| Manufacturing Integration Challenge | Traditional Approach | Modern Partner-Led Approach |
|---|---|---|
| Production updates to ERP | Batch CSV imports or manual entry | Real-time middleware orchestration with validation and retry logic |
| Inventory synchronization | Periodic reconciliation | Event-driven stock movement integration across shop floor, WMS, and ERP |
| Quality and scrap reporting | Standalone quality records | Connected workflows linking quality systems, MES, and ERP costing |
| Multi-site visibility | Site-specific custom scripts | Cloud-native integration platform with centralized governance and observability |

High-value synchronization scenarios between shop floor and ERP
The strongest opportunities usually begin with a narrow operational pain point and expand into a broader connected business systems roadmap. Common synchronization scenarios include production order release from ERP to MES, machine or operator-reported completion data back to ERP, material consumption updates, lot and serial traceability, downtime event synchronization, quality hold workflows, maintenance-triggered production impacts, and shipment readiness updates into warehouse and customer service systems.
For example, an ERP partner serving a mid-market discrete manufacturer may start by integrating production order data from ERP into a shop floor execution system. Once that flow is stable, the same customer often needs labor reporting, scrap capture, inventory movement synchronization, and quality event integration. API modernization recommendations for shop floor and ERP connectivity
API modernization should not be treated as a pure technical refresh. It is a business scalability strategy. Many manufacturing environments still expose data through flat files, database polling, proprietary interfaces, or tightly coupled middleware. Partners should modernize these interactions by introducing governed APIs, event-based messaging where appropriate, canonical data models for production and inventory events, and policy-driven routing between systems. This improves maintainability, accelerates onboarding of new plants or applications, and supports enterprise scalability.
A practical modernization path often includes wrapping legacy interfaces with APIs, normalizing transaction payloads, separating orchestration from endpoint logic, and implementing centralized authentication, logging, and version control. For manufacturers with mixed technology maturity, the goal is not to replace every legacy system immediately. The goal is to create a cloud-native integration platform layer that can bridge old and new systems while improving governance and reducing operational risk.
Governance and operational resilience considerations
Manufacturing synchronization is operationally sensitive. If production completions fail to post, inventory may become inaccurate. If quality holds do not reach ERP, shipments may proceed incorrectly. If downtime events are not visible, planning and costing suffer. That is why API governance and integration governance must be built into the service model. Partners should define data ownership, transaction retry policies, exception workflows, audit trails, role-based access, versioning standards, and change management procedures from the start.
| Governance Area | Recommendation | Partner Value |
|---|---|---|
| API lifecycle management | Version APIs and document plant-to-ERP transaction contracts | Reduces support friction and accelerates future enhancements |
| Monitoring and observability | Track transaction success, latency, queue depth, and exception trends | Creates managed service value and operational intelligence |
| Security and access control | Apply role-based access, credential rotation, and endpoint policies | Improves trust and supports enterprise requirements |
| Change management | Use controlled deployment pipelines and rollback procedures | Protects production continuity and lowers outage risk |
| Data quality controls | Validate units, lot data, item mappings, and status codes | Prevents downstream ERP and reporting errors |
Implementation tradeoffs partners should discuss with manufacturing clients
Not every synchronization flow needs real-time processing, and not every plant can support the same architecture. Executive recommendations should balance business urgency, technical debt, and operational readiness. Real-time integration is valuable for inventory, production status, and exception handling, but scheduled synchronization may be sufficient for lower-priority reference data. Direct API calls can simplify some workflows, while asynchronous orchestration may be better for resilience and throughput. A partner that frames these tradeoffs clearly builds credibility and avoids overengineering.
Implementation planning should also account for plant network constraints, legacy equipment interfaces, ERP transaction rules, master data consistency, and support ownership after go-live. The strongest delivery model is phased: start with one plant or one workflow, establish governance and observability, then scale across additional lines, facilities, and adjacent systems.
